用MFC界面实现。。求指导。。感谢各位大侠

[复制链接]
查看11 | 回复3 | 2011-5-14 09:22:09 | 显示全部楼层 |阅读模式
通讯录管理系统
一、设计方法和基本原理
1.课题功能描述
通讯录中的信息包括:姓名,分组,qq号码或MSN,邮箱,固定电话,手机号码(也可以根据需要自行设计)。要求建立通讯录类,包括通讯录中的信息和对这些信息操作的函数。
使用MFC,编写基于对话框的Windows应用程序,当用户输入一条记录后,将其保存在记事本中。并可使用列表框(或者组合框),选择姓名,可以查找其他信息。
2.问题详细描述
自然数的分解是一个基于对话框的Windows应用程序。该程序包含两个对话框:主对话框和帮助对话框(由主对话框启动)。
在主对话框中,用户输入通讯录信息,进行保存;在列表框或者组合框中,选择姓名,将信息显示出来。
帮助对话框中对本程序的使用方法进行说明,并由主对话框启动。
3.问题的解决方案
根据问题描述,可以将问题解决分为三步:
1)使用VisualC中的MFCAppWizard创建基于对话框的应用程序。
2)使用VisualC中的资源编辑器对程序中的对话框进行可视化编辑,实现程序所需的操作界面。照题目要求,设计友好方便的图形用户界面,以实现程序功能。
3)使用ClassWizard编辑对话框所对应的对话框类,为对话框中的控件添加成员变量来操纵控件,为对话框中的控件建立消息映射和消息映射函数,最后编写函数代码实现其功能。
二、主要技术问题的描述
根据分析,主要问题在于:
问题的分析和描述可参考《C语言程序设计教程》中的通讯录程序。
要求在程序中用类来实现对通讯录的操作。
三、创新要求
实现程序功能后,可进行创新设计:提高操作方便性,例如每次录入后,可将通讯录保存到文件中。
回复

使用道具 举报

千问 | 2011-5-14 09:22:09 | 显示全部楼层
输入用:文本框、单选框(性别)、下拉框(电话只要存一个的话)、显示用列表(listControl)
保存在记事本中就用FILE操作!直接写入读出在弄四个按钮上去增、删、查、改四个功能!
基本上你的要求就出来了,这个还真没有什么函数要你自己去写的,都是调用MFC封装好了的
函数。
那个帮助对话框你也做一按钮直接调出来就行!上面放一个静态文本域想写啥帮助上去就写啥帮助!以前我开始学的时候也写过类似的代码!用MySql数据库存的数据!很简简单的。。。
回复

使用道具 举报

千问 | 2011-5-14 09:22:09 | 显示全部楼层
嗯。就是那些什么建立类向导,新建还是改类名什么的都不是很清楚,不明白到底有什么联系,怎么联系
回复

使用道具 举报

千问 | 2011-5-14 09:22:09 | 显示全部楼层
这个。。。。还是找本入门的书来看看吧。。。在这里打字就太夸张了。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行